This is the website for HKS Speedloaders; they carry both speedloaders and a variety of speedloader carriers (including single and double black leather). Carriers are available in a variety of materials (leather, cordura, or synthetic leather) and with a variety of closure options (exposed or hidden brass, nickel, or subdued black snaps; velcro).

They have most sizes/calibers for speedloaders and carrying cases (including 7-shot S&W revolver).

They advertise all their carriers as fitting 2.5" or narrower belts. I've had no problems with mine mounted on 1.75" nylon duty belts.

I have bought the synthetic leather ones (Dupont Hytrel) for several rigs including my .357's and
.41's. Very nice quality, don't absorb sweat, and extremely dificult to distinguish from real leather.

I have been very pleased with their products, prices and delivery.

Instead of round speed loaders have you tried Bianchi Speed Strips? They hold six in a line and are easier to conceal. Yes they are slower than speed loaders but are much easier to conceal. I believe you can get from Dillon Precision.
 
I was about to suggest Bianchi Speed Strips too. They are better for CCW but not as fast as speedloaders. You can buy a case to carry extra rounds which can carry speed strips too.
